Sour Diesel, often called Sour D, is a celebrated sativa-dominant strain that emerged in the early 1990s. It is recognized for its potent cerebral effects, energetic uplift, and distinctive aromatic profile, making it a long-standing favorite among cannabis users.
Appearance
Sour Diesel buds are typically dense and resinous, displaying a vibrant green color often interspersed with purple and yellow hues. They are generously coated in trichomes, giving them a frosty, crystalline look. Bright orange to deep rust-colored pistils are also commonly observed weaving through the compact buds.
Aroma & Flavor
The aroma of Sour Diesel is famously pungent and diesel-like, with notes reminiscent of fuel, burnt rubber, and chemical undertones. Its flavor profile mirrors the aroma, offering sharp diesel notes with a tangy, sour bite, often complemented by hints of citrus, earthiness, and a subtle skunky finish.
Effects
Users commonly report fast-acting cerebral stimulation from Sour Diesel, leading to a dreamy, euphoric mental state. It is known for inducing creativity, focus, and a significant boost in energy and mood, making it suitable for daytime activities.
Terpenes & Cannabinoids
Sour Diesel typically exhibits high THC levels, often ranging from 20% to 26%, with minimal CBD content. Terpene analysis often shows terpinolene as a dominant terpene, contributing citrus and floral notes, alongside myrcene and pinene which add earthiness and pine sharpness. This combination contributes to the strain's unique sensory experience and psychoactive effects.
Origins & Lineage
Emerging in the early 1990s, Sour Diesel is a hybrid descendant of Chemdawg and Super Skunk. This genetic combination is credited with its potent effects and robust profile, establishing its legendary status in the cannabis community.
